Climate Considerations



When intending a business paint project, weather condition factors to consider are important. You require to watch on temperature level and moisture degrees, as they can considerably affect paint application and drying out times.

Ideally, you want to arrange your job throughout moderate climate-- temperatures in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F are typically best for many paints. Severe warm can cause the paint to completely dry too rapidly, causing fractures, while low temperature levels can reduce drying, allowing dust and particles to decide on the wet surface.


Rainfall is another aspect to take into consideration. Painting outside during wet conditions can cause poor adhesion and a higher chance of peeling off later on. It's important to examine the forecast and plan your job for a stretch of dry days.

Wind can likewise be a problem, specifically if you're working with spray paint, as it can trigger overspray and unequal protection.

Finally, seasonal adjustments can modify your timeline. Spring and fall frequently give the most positive conditions, so consider these periods when arranging your business paint job.

Seasonal Trends and Need



Comprehending seasonal trends and need is crucial for intending your industrial paint task successfully. Various seasons bring varying weather, which can significantly affect the timing of your job.

Springtime and early summertime typically existing the very best possibilities for outside painting, as the temperatures are moderate and completely dry. This is when need usually comes to a head, so scheduling early can guarantee you safeguard the right specialist at a competitive price.

Fall can also be a blast for exterior work, as many services look to freshen their rooms before winter. Nevertheless, as temperature levels decrease, you may face hold-ups due to weather restrictions.

On the other hand, winter season is usually an off-peak season, making it a cost-efficient time for interior paint. With less projects on the table, service providers are commonly extra flexible and can prioritize your needs.

Remember that holidays and neighborhood events can affect accessibility, so plan in advance.
